Sigh, okay, haha, this video is of our visit to Sleep Fox Distillery who specializes in Moonshine. the service was so nice, kind, & fun. The tastings options are broad and something for everyone as there are flavored moonshines, standard moonshine, bourbon, and vodka. Liquor is not my go-to drink but I still enjoy tasting and discovering. we really enjoyed Sleep Fox and it's SUPER close to our location, just north of Richmond on route 1 right off of I-95.
